What Is IMS SIS?
IMS SIS is a cloud-driven solution designed for overseeing the entire lifecycle of Safety Instrumented Systems. It incorporates methodologies like HAZOP, LOPA, and SIF design verification, along with revision management and digital overhaul as well as proof testing. This software serves as a comprehensive repository for functional safety data, enabling asset, safety, and operations managers to enhance compliance, synchronize efforts across various disciplines, and ensure audit readiness throughout the SIS lifecycle.
IMS SIS Pricing
The cost of IMS SIS ranges from $60 to $150 per user each month, based on industry standards for comparable cloud-based facility and asset management tools. This pricing spectrum is meant for general budgeting, as actual expenses may vary depending on user count, chosen modules, custom workflows, ERP or database integrations, and specific enterprise requirements such as role-based security and compliance measures.
In addition to the standard subscription fees, organizations should consider these additional costs:
Implementation And Configuration: $1,000–$5,000 for small cloud setups; $5,000–$25,000 for medium-sized deployments; $25,000–$60,000+ for intricate multi-site installations
Data Migration: $1,000–$10,000 based on asset volume, the quality of legacy data, and complexity of conversion
Training And Onboarding: $500–$10,000 for basic to tailored instructor-led training sessions depending on team size
ERP/System Integrations: $1,000–$5,000 for standard API connections; $10,000–$50,000+ for extensive ERP or multi-system integrations
Premium Support And Add-Ons: $50–$300 per user annually for advanced support options

Is IMS SIS Right For You?
This software is designed for asset-intensive environments that necessitate structured safety lifecycle management along with adherence to IEC 61508 and IEC 61511 standards. It integrates HAZOP, LOPA, and SIF verification processes while providing centralized data for audits and offering configurable roles for cross-team collaboration. With its cloud-based framework, it ensures both scalability and secure deployment. It is trusted by global organizations like Borealis and Equinor, supporting teams that prioritize functional safety and regulatory compliance.
